Abstract
A heart valve prosthesis having an annular valve housing or base and two leaflets supported for pivotable movement within the annular valve housing. Each valve leaflet possesses a composite curvature shape with pivoting hinges being purposely offset to the hydraulic force center of the annular valve housing to provide fast response of the leaflets to flow direction change. The hinge mechanism includes modified serpentine curved hinge recesses in the annular valve housing for receiving elongated leaflet ears allowing the leaflets to change their motion modes approaching the closed position to reduce leaflet-edge tangential velocity and impact of the minor edges against one another and the major edges against the housing seat upon closure. The composite curvature leaflets allow maximal central flow with consequent lower pressure drop during the open phase and minimal regurgitation during the closing phase. The curved leaflet major trailing edges in the open position reduces boundary separation and associated turbulence along the flow stream direction.
